The version i have - got it back when it first came out, also in the
tin box - has much more than just deathmatch. The opening screen,
after the movie, has single player, multiplayer, and a few other
options. In both single player and multiplayer, you have the option to
create a game (it might be called `skirmish' in the single player
menu). When you create a game, you choose the game type - click on
where it says (iirc) `deathmatch' and you can cycle through the other
game types. There should be at least team deathmatch and capture the
flag.

Don't forget to update to the lasted point release.
